Revitalizing Economic Stability in Latin America and the Caribbean

As Latin America and the Caribbean face unprecedented challenges in the wake of global economic shifts, a concerted effort to bolster growth is essential. Several key initiatives could serve as cornerstones in revitalizing economic stability across the region:

  • Investment in Sustainable Infrastructure: Enhancing transportation, energy, and digital networks will not only create jobs but also improve access to markets.
  • Promotion of Small and Medium Enterprises (SMEs): Providing better access to credit and resources can help drive innovation and growth at the local level.
  • Strengthening Trade Agreements: Expanding and diversifying trade partnerships can open new markets and reduce economic vulnerabilities.
  • Enhancing Workforce Skills: Equipping citizens with the necessary skills to thrive in an evolving job market will ensure economic resilience.

Fostering Innovation and Sustainable Development for Future Growth

Innovation and sustainable development are essential pillars that can shape the future trajectory of Latin America and the Caribbean. By embracing a holistic approach that intertwines economic growth with environmental stewardship, nations can unlock new opportunities for their citizens. Businesses, governments, and communities must collaborate to implement strategies that prioritize sustainable practices. Key initiatives could include:

  • Investing in Renewable Energy: Transitioning from fossil fuels to solar and wind energy can create jobs while reducing carbon footprints.
  • Promoting Green Technology: Encouraging the use of eco-friendly technologies in industries can spur innovation and improve efficiencies.
  • Sustainable Agriculture: Implementing eco-conscious farming practices not only ensures food security but also protects biodiversity.

Furthermore, fostering a culture of innovation is crucial for sustaining long-term growth. Education systems should be aligned with market needs, emphasizing STEM fields, and entrepreneurship, to equip the next generation with the necessary skills. Collaborations between academia and industry can facilitate research and development that directly benefits local economies. To support this vision, governments could establish:

  • Innovation Hubs: Spaces that bring together startups, researchers, and investors to exchange ideas and develop solutions.
  • Access to Funding: Initiatives that provide financial support and incentives for innovative projects can stimulate local economies.
  • Regulatory Frameworks: Policies that support innovation and protect intellectual property can empower inventors and entrepreneurs.

Strengthening Regional Cooperation to Overcome Common Challenges

In the face of persistent economic challenges, the nations of Latin America and the Caribbean must prioritize collaboration to forge robust solutions. The region is confronted with issues such as climate change, food security, and economic inequality, which require a unified approach. By fostering regional partnerships, countries can share resources, knowledge, and strategies that amplify their collective strength. Initiatives like joint disaster response strategies and collaborative agricultural projects can play a pivotal role in building resilience and enhancing stability.

Moreover, harnessing technology and innovation is critical in this collective endeavor. Countries should consider establishing regional innovation hubs that focus on sustainable practices and emerging technologies. These hubs can serve as incubators for ideas that address local challenges while promoting economic diversification. As discussions to strengthen trade agreements and investment frameworks continue, the focus must remain on creating inclusive growth that benefits all sectors of society. Through shared commitment and cooperation, Latin America and the Caribbean can better navigate the complexities of today’s world.
